Boston, MA (WiredPRNews.com) Crooner Brian Evans and Charlie Sheen hung out a bit backstage in Boston during Sheen’s April 12th Agganis Arena appearance. Evans was in Boston to deal with his song “At Fenway,” which is being worked on for The Boston Red Sox. Evans is also recording under producer Narada Michael Walden (who also produced the “At Fenway” song).
Evans gifted Sheen with a 1956 Topps Ted Williams card realizing Sheen was a fan of the player. Says Evans, “I told Charlie I wanted him to have the card. I dig knowing that it is no longer in my safe because Charlie Sheen now has it,” laughs Evans. “Charlie Sheen is completely opposite of the way he is portrayed in the media. He was appreciative of every little thing in a way you wouldn’t expect. A total class act who handles the media storm around him with incredible stamina and ease.”
Evans, who has returned to Maui, produces The Maui Celebrity Series (www.mauicelebrityseries.com). He opens for the likes of Jay Leno in Las Vegas, and is also involved in the creation of a graphic novel series entitled “Horrorscope” with Ahmet Zappa.
Evans and William Shatner will perform on New Years Eve this year at The Maui Theatre. The two will perform a duet of “Rocketman,” the first time Shatner has ever performed the song as a duet live.
